| Forced
Air Ventilation
You
can use a variety of control strategies to operate ventilation
fans. In climate control situations, the operation of the
ventilation fans is coordinated with your heating system to
maximize energy efficiency.
For
multi-fan applications, the Batavia system regulates the operation
of fans based on the current calculated ventilating requirement.
Fans can be operated individually or in groups to achieve
varied ventilation rates. Each fan can be controlled using
a simple off/on strategy, or with pulse width modulation (PWM).
With PWM control, the control system regulates the on/off
times as well as the numbers of fans operating to precisely
match the current cooling or dehumidification requirements.
This results in exceptional temperature control precision.
Fan operation can also be coordinated with evaporative cooling
pad(s) systems.
